Fusion, the process that powers the Sun and Stars, is one of the most promising options for generating the cleaner, carbon-free energy that our world badly needs. UKAEA are at the forefront of realising energy from fusion, working with industry and research partners to deliver the ground-breaking developments that will underpin tomorrow's fusion power stations with the aim of bringing fusion electricity to the grid. The UKAEA is undergoing an exciting transformation as it scales up to meet the test of positioning the UK as a head in fusion energy. As part of this there is a requirement to establish the optimum Portfolio, Programme and Project (P3M) construct.

The Centre of Excellence Lead will drive forward the Delivery Life Cycle (DLC) culture at UKAEA, ensure that the P3M processes across the organization are effective, that the DLC is being complied with and tailored effectively, develop and deliver appropriate training, manage knowledge (including lessons learned), provide self-reliant assurance, ensure three lines of defence assurance is being complied with, and promote a culture that focuses on a Less is More approach, benefits realisation and demonstrating value for money. They will also act as an internal consultancy offering advice on project selection, controlled start-up, whole lifecycle delivery and benefits realisation.
